Who Are Dream’s Main Customers?

Understanding the customer demographics and target market of the company involves analyzing its diverse operations across both consumer (B2C) and business (B2B) sectors. The company's strategic focus on sustainable living and community-oriented developments indicates a B2C target market that values urban living, potentially including young professionals, growing families, and empty nesters. This approach aligns with broader market trends favoring environmentally conscious and community-focused lifestyles.

The B2B segment is extensive, encompassing commercial office spaces, industrial properties, and impact investments. The company serves businesses of various sizes, from small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) to large corporations, through its real estate investment trusts (REITs). Additionally, it caters to institutional investors and individuals interested in impact investing via its Dream Impact Trust, indicating a growing focus on environ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ors.

The company's commitment to ESG and impact investing is reflected in its strategic shifts, responding to evolving market demands. The company's asset management division serves third-party investors seeking expertise in real estate and renewable energy asset management. The fastest-growing segments are likely within impact investing and renewable energy infrastructure, highlighting the company's adaptability to market trends.

Where does Dream operate?

The geographical market presence of Dream Unlimited Corp. is predominantly centered in Canada. The company strategically focuses on key urban centers, establishing a strong foothold and brand recognition across various real estate sectors. Analyzing the Brief History of Dream reveals its commitment to the Canadian market.

Dream's primary markets include major cities such as Toronto, Ottawa, Montreal, Calgary, Edmonton, Regina, and Saskatoon. These locations are crucial for its operations, where it maintains a significant market share. The company's real estate investments, including those of Dream Office REIT and Dream Industrial REIT, are largely concentrated within these Canadian urban areas.

The company's understanding of local market dynamics is key to its success. Dream tailors its offerings to meet the specific needs and preferences of each city. This approach includes adapting architectural designs, community amenities, and marketing campaigns to resonate with local populations, ensuring relevance and appeal.

Icon Market Expansion

Dream Industrial REIT has expanded its footprint into the United States and Europe. This expansion is driven by diversification and capitalizing on growth opportunities in logistics and e-commerce. Recent market entries often involve partnerships or acquisitions to ensure effective market penetration.

How Does Dream Win & Keep Customers?

Dream Unlimited Corp. (Dream) employs a comprehensive strategy for acquiring and retaining customers, tailored to the specific needs of its diverse business segments. This approach involves a blend of traditional and digital marketing, targeted sales tactics, and relationship-focused initiatives. The goal is to build lasting relationships with customers and investors, driving long-term value. Understanding Growth Strategy of Dream is crucial for grasping how customer acquisition and retention fit into the broader corporate vision.

For residential developments, Dream focuses on attracting potential buyers through online property listings, social media campaigns, and virtual tours. Traditional advertising in local media is also used. Sales efforts involve dedicated sales centers, partnerships with real estate agents, and personalized consultations to guide potential buyers. Dream's commercial arm targets businesses seeking office or industrial space through industry-specific publications, real estate brokerage networks, and direct outreach. This multifaceted approach aims to reach a broad range of potential customers.

Dream Asset Management relies heavily on its reputation and track record to acquire new mandates from institutional and high-net-worth investors. This includes building relationships, delivering investor presentations, and participating in industry conferences. For retention, particularly within its REITs, Dream emphasizes high-quality property management services, proactive communication with tenants, and ensuring tenant satisfaction through responsive maintenance and amenity offerings. These efforts are designed to foster customer loyalty and long-term partnerships.
